How much do outside sales representative construction j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for outside sales representative construction in the United States is $78,042.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,500.00 and $90,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does an Outside Sales Representative in Construction typically collaborate with project managers and estimators?

Outside Sales Representatives in construction frequently work closely with project managers and estimators to ensure proposals are accurate and client needs are met. They relay customer requirements, provide product or service details, and help resolve any issues that may arise during the bidding or project phases. Effective communication and teamwork are essential, as sales reps often serve as the bridge between clients and the internal team, ensuring project timelines and client expectations are aligned.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Outside Sales Representative in Construction, and why are they important?

To excel as an Outside Sales Representative in Construction, you need strong sales acumen, in-depth construction industry knowledge, and typically a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with CRM software, estimating tools, and project management systems is often required. Excellent communication, relationship-building, and negotiation skills help you stand out in this client-facing role. These competencies are crucial for building trust, closing deals, and effectively managing long sales cycles in a competitive industry.

What does an Outside Sales Representative in Construction do?

An Outside Sales Representative in construction is responsible for generating new business and maintaining relationships with clients in the construction industry. They often travel to job sites, meet with contractors, builders, and project managers, and promote relevant construction products or services. Their duties include identifying potential customers, giving product demonstrations, preparing bids or proposals, and negotiating contracts to meet sales targets. This role requires strong communication, negotiation skills, and a good understanding of construction processes and products.
